In the presence of the inner electrons, the nuclear pull for the outer electrons is said to be less. This is due to the shielding of the outer electrons by the inner ones. This nuclear attraction is less than the actual nuclear charge.

This amount of nuclear attraction is measured by a constant called shielding constant as is given by the following expression:

Z* = Z-σ

Z* = Effective nuclear charge

Z = Atomic number

σ = Shielding constant
